Output 28f85cb624c8b38d74cf5d7bbec799b15abe58c1de6b4dae959b3a941e382777:0
- value
- 2100000000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 70565a339d060c3c1efde578d9b80ef2c3a917e8 OP_EQUAL
- address
- 3Bw13tsoHuGPt8yPffahrTeomUMRvH2yzT
- transaction
- 28f85cb624c8b38d74cf5d7bbec799b15abe58c1de6b4dae959b3a941e382777
- confirmations
- 278764
- spent
- true